Spyro Embraces New Purpose: God’s Ambassador in the Industry

Spyro Declares himself God’s Ambassador, Committed to Influencing the Industry with Positive Music

Up-and-coming Nigerian singer, Spyro, recently took to his Instagram page to declare himself as a representative of God. He expressed his belief that God has assigned him a mission in the industry to bring about positive changes.

Spyro emphasized his commitment to promoting music that is timeless and devoid of explicit or ungodly lyrics, explicitly stating his disinterest in creating songs focused on shaking of the body or containing questionable content. His primary goal is to uphold and promote what is right and pleasing to the ear.

With a firm resolve, Spyro asserted that he will influence the industry for God, even if it takes time. He affirmed his purpose and proclaimed himself as God’s ambassador, determined to make a significant impact.
